The cheapest way to get from Pasco to Santa Cruz is to drive which costs $140 - $210 and takes 14h 32m.
The fastest way to get from Pasco to Santa Cruz is to fly and Caltrain and bus which takes 4h 31m and costs $150 - $430.
No, there is no direct bus from Pasco to Santa Cruz. However, there are services departing from Pasco Bus Stop and arriving at Soquel Ave & Front via Portland Curbside Bus Stop, Sacramento Bus Station, Stockton and Diridon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 24h 21m.
The distance between Pasco and Santa Cruz is 690 miles. The road distance is 793 miles.
The best way to get from Pasco to Santa Cruz without a car is to bus which takes 24h 21m and costs $160 - $300.
